Ticket: drift detected between the Maplewright staging and production planner settings, likely explaining the query planner regression reported after last Tuesday's deploy. Staging had the new cost model enabled while production silently reverted during a config sync, so join reordering diverged and the orders dashboard queries fell off the index path. I've reconciled the files and added a drift check to CI. For the weekly sync, the reconciled production values we are now running are listed below.

settings of bawif-fawif:
ralix:
  log_level: warn
  metrics_host: metrics.ralix.tolvaqsys.internal
  pool_size: 32

Meeting Notes — Field Clinic Logistics, 14th

Quick recap from the cooler-transport chat. The two vaccine coolers for the Marrowvale field clinic go out Friday morning — Petra's checking the ice-pack stock today, and Joss is printing the temperature logs. Courier is Larkspan Medical Transit; they'll bring their own straps. Office manager to confirm the booking window by Thursday noon. Oh, and when the driver shows up, make sure they're given the instruction noted right below.

handover note for yagef-bagep: the drudor pelius courier leaves the kasdor zorvan norir ledger at gate 8016 under passcode 755406

Quick recap for the coordinator: the three ceramic pieces on loan from the Aldermoor Collection go back next Tuesday, not Friday as originally planned — their registrar moved things up. Mira will have them crated and condition-checked by Monday close of business. Driver needs the padded van, and the crates ride upright, no stacking. Someone from curatorial will meet the vehicle at their loading bay. We agreed the courier hand-over instruction would be noted right below these minutes.

dispatch memo: the quenax olidor courier leaves the lamvan aldath keliel ledger at gate 2085 under passcode 005795